Unlocking the Power of Ultrasonic Metal Degreasers in the Chemical Coating Industry
In the industrial world, cleanliness is critical, especially when it comes to preparing metal surfaces for coatings. One of the most effective technologies in achieving this is the ultrasonic metal degreaser. This specialized cleaning equipment utilizes high-frequency sound waves to create microscopic bubbles in a cleaning solution. These bubbles collapse upon contact with the surface, producing powerful tiny shock waves that effectively dislodge contaminants such as oils, grease, and dirt from metal substrates.
Ultrasonic cleaning is particularly advantageous in the chemical coatings industry, where the quality of the surface preparation directly influences the adhesion and performance of the applied coatings. Whether dealing with intricate parts or large flat surfaces, ultrasonic metal degreasers ensure every nook and cranny is thoroughly cleansed, creating an ideal foundation for subsequent coating layers.
One of the primary benefits of ultrasonic metal degreasers is their efficiency. Traditional cleaning methods often involve labor-intensive processes or harsh chemicals that can be detrimental to both the environment and the materials being cleaned. In contrast, ultrasonic cleaning can drastically reduce cleaning times and minimize the need for harmful solvents. By utilizing water-based solutions or biodegradable detergents, businesses can adopt more sustainable practices while maintaining high standards of cleanliness.
Another significant advantage is the versatility of ultrasonic degreasers. These machines can be tailored to accommodate various cleaning solutions and can be adjusted to suit different materials and contaminants. This adaptability makes them an ideal choice for businesses within the coatings industry that may work with a variety of metals and coatings, ensuring that each cleaning process meets specific requirements.
In addition to their cleaning capabilities, ultrasonic metal degreasers can enhance the overall efficiency of production lines. By ensuring that metal parts are impeccably cleaned before coating, businesses can reduce the likelihood of defects, rework, and waste. This not only saves time but also contributes to significant cost savings over time.
Moreover, ultrasonic cleaning systems can also improve workplace safety. By reducing the reliance on harsh chemicals and manual labor, companies can create a safer work environment for their employees. This aligns with the growing trend towards sustainability and environmental responsibility in industrial practices.
In conclusion, ultrasonic metal degreasers play a crucial role in the chemical coatings industry, delivering efficient, effective, and environmentally friendly cleaning solutions. By integrating these advanced machines into their operations, businesses can ensure superior surface preparation, reduce production costs, and maintain high-quality standards in their coating applications. Embracing ultrasonic technology not only enhances productivity but also supports a commitment to sustainability in the industrial sector.
